The Organization: SAGE is a multi-service agency that has provided services to older people in Edmonton and area since 1970. Its mission is to enhance the quality of life of older people. ' H7 _. N0 t" p7 H% \
! p9 `& c* n, _) [
This position is responsible for assessing client needs and short term one on one counseling to individuals addressing the social/emotional needs of older adults & their families. The position will focus on assisting seniors or their families, who make contact with SAGE, to articulate/prioritize their needs, deal with issues they are facing and to make informed referrals as necessary.
^' {! N- U$ h" \4 Y. I% m! L$ c6 J. a
As a professional social worker, the incumbent will adhere to the Social Work Code of Ethics as published in the A.C.S.W., and be a member in good standing of the AARSW. This position will work with the Housing Coordinator, Seniors Social Worker, Safe House Coordinators, the Full House Coordinator and volunteers on the reception/telephone lines.& d: P( l6 B$ N( l( n+ r+ e

The Ideal Candidate: is a Registered Social Worker, College or University prepared, holds a valid First Aid certificate, is able to provide a Criminal Record Check that is free of criminal convictions, has (and be prepared to use) a vehicle/possess a valid Class 5 driver’s license, and is able to obtain $1 million auto liability insurance with a rider that permits transportation of clients.
9 o; x0 M( e" \, O& w& N( Y$ |" E
He/she has experience in community-based case management/assessment, is able to demonstrate a good understanding of the needs of older people, is knowledgeable of community resources & services related to older people, is self-motivated/able to work as part of a team, has excellent communication & problem solving skills, has familiarity/experience with issues related to senior volunteers and is computer literate especially with MS Word & Excel.
